The Challenges of Traveling  

While travel is exciting, it poses several challenges to physical and mental well-being:

  1. Fatigue: Long flights, time zone changes, and disrupted sleep patterns can lead to exhaustion and jet lag.
  2. Stress: Navigating airports, meeting tight schedules, and managing unexpected delays can elevate cortisol levels.
  3. Muscle Tension: Prolonged sitting during flights or road trips often leads to muscle stiffness and cramps.
  4. Digestive Upset: Changes in routine, dehydration, and unfamiliar foods can disrupt digestion.

The Role of Magnesium in Travel Wellness  

Magnesium is a critical mineral involved in over 300 enzymatic processes in the body, many of which are directly related to managing stress, energy production, and muscle relaxation. Key benefits include:

  1. Energy Support: Magnesium is essential for ATP production, the energy currency of the body, helping combat fatigue and jet lag.
  2. Stress Regulation: By modulating the hypothalamic-pituitary-adrenal (HPA) axis, magnesium helps regulate cortisol, the body’s primary stress hormone.
  3. Muscle Relaxation: Magnesium prevents calcium buildup in muscle cells, reducing cramps, stiffness, and tension after prolonged sitting.
  4. Sleep Enhancement: Magnesium supports melatonin production and promotes relaxation, aiding in sleep quality during time zone changes.

Why Magnesium Glycinate is the Best Choice for Travelers  

Among the various forms of magnesium, magnesium glycinate stands out for its efficacy in travel wellness:

  1. High Absorption: Magnesium is highly bioavailable, ensuring optimal delivery to tissues.
  2. Gentle on Digestion: Unlike magnesium citrate or oxide, magnesium glycinate is less likely to cause gastrointestinal discomfort, such as diarrhea, making it ideal for travelers.
  3. Glycine’s Relaxing Effects: Glycine, an amino acid bound to magnesium in this compound, has its own calming properties, enhancing stress relief and improving sleep quality.

Practical Tips for Using Magnesium Glycinate While Traveling  

  1. Dosage Recommendations
  • For general wellness: 200–400 mg of elemental magnesium per day.
  • For jet lag or stress management: Take magnesium glycinate 1–2 hours before bedtime to support relaxation and sleep.
  1. Timing
  • Before Travel: Take magnesium glycinate the night before to optimize sleep and reduce pre-travel stress.
  • During Travel: Use it to manage muscle stiffness or stress during long flights or drives.
  • After Travel: Take it to recover from fatigue and restore circadian rhythm balance.
  1. Hydration
  • Pair magnesium supplementation with adequate water intake to maximize absorption and reduce dehydration-related discomfort.

Limitations and Safety Considerations  

  1. Consult a Healthcare Provider: Individuals with kidney disease or other chronic conditions should consult a healthcare provider before starting magnesium supplementation.
  2. Avoid Overuse: Stick to recommended dosages to avoid side effects like drowsiness or mild digestive upset.
  3. Supplement Quality: Choose a high-quality magnesium glycinate product from a reputable brand to ensure safety and efficacy.
